I’m hoping that someone can point me to where I can find historical information on Australian domestic air fares.

I remember seeing something on a government website, but that didn’t provide any breakdown aside from month to month, for the whole of Australia.

Specifically, I’m looking at airfares from the West coast to the East coast, around 2 years ago.

Any help would be appreciated.
 
For information regarding Airfares and traffic best stop is the BIRTE (Bureau Infrastructure and Regional Economics) which is the new version of DoTARS

bitre. gov. au

There are a few PDF and excel spreadsheets on Ticket prices and volume from 1992 and their earlier annual reports go back further including pre-pilots dispute...Great resource used in many a presentation

Usually just search Airfares and should work

Hope this is what you were after...there search function is a little clunky but should turn up desired results after refining search options (typical government site)

AirservicesAustralia also return some useful data

the "avline" documents on the BIRTE website also contain data and more detailed city pair data and i know that there is, somewhere is the abyss of a website that it is, an excel spreadsheet which has city pair by city pair data including avg Y airfare, load factor RSK, ASK's etc

I did a quick search for you but could not find sorry, just trawl the search function i recall that is what i did when i last looked for it.

Sadly most data for airfares is not in real terms but rather indexed. which is annoying
